two.1.4) Short description

The project will provide dedicated, targeted, demand-led consultancy and solutions, delivered by a third-party expert in the market. The project has been designed to be a service managed by an organisation, that can engage a range of consultancy within the region, working in partnership with WECA Growth Hub, in developing leads and referrals to the project.

The objective of the support is to enable businesses to not only put in place new systems to improve their productivity and competitiveness, but also approaches to entering new markets, attracting new customers and increasing sales, with the aim of supporting growth in turn over and employment. All of which are essential to support business growth and the route to recovery post COVID -19.

The scope has been designed to encourage applicants to propose innovative approaches to technology adoption and increases in productivity and resilience. We welcome applications that can demonstrate a real understanding of the needs of businesses across the West of England, which will deliver interventions that can ensure a genuine business benefit.

WECA is working with a number of providers on additional technology support initiatives, including Be the Business with their ‘Tech Adoption Lad’ and Founders4Schoolds ‘Digital Boost’ platform. The successful applicant will be expected to work in partnership, alongside these organisations and WECA, ensuring that business receive a cohesive package of support and are seamlessly referred across projects.
